Raury calls on Big K.R.I.T. for "Forbidden Knowledge." The 2015 XXL Freshman races with the beat as he drops knowledge on forbidden truths. "Forbidden knowledge is too great for a man," says Raury in the opening seconds of the track. He then goes on to question the way we function as a society in both social and political aspects. "There's a universe in her afro/Hold us back tho/There's power in the Black folk/Well that's forbidden knowledge/At first they wanna keep us separate by equal/But it's not, so we fight against the hatred and evil/Now they let us think we got it and they killin' our people/While this history repeat like a sequel/Well that's forbidden knowledge," he raps. Once K.R.I.T. comes in, he also has several questions of his own, like, "Who put the liquor store across the street from the gun shop?" The track not only bumps, but makes you seriously consider the rappers' lyrics. "I think the agenda's meant to kill us all/Now what good is education when you can ball?" asks K.R.I.T. Take a listen to the track above and get ready to take some notes.

"Forbidden Knowledge" is featured on Raury's forthcoming debut album, All We Need. The LP hits shelves on Oct. 16. The young MC shared the cover art and tracklist for his LP last month. Preorder your copy now over on iTunes.
